Background technology
Wasp also cries wasp, there will be a known kind more than 5000 in the world, and what China recorded has more than 200 to plant, and is widely distributed in China.Wasp honeycomb can make traditional Chinese medicine, has analgesic therapy, expelling parasite, subdhing swelling and detoxicating effect, cures mainly frightened epilepsy, wandering arthritis, acute mastitis, toothache, stubborn dermatitis, cancer etc.; Wasp wine is dispelled rheumatism, and controls anxious, slow rheumatalgia, rheumatic arthritis; Wasp aptoxin can treatment of arthritis, arthralgia due to wind-dampness etc., and medical value is high, has great significance to the research and production of medical new product, and current international market has more than 20 kind of wasp aptoxin sell, prices are rather stiff for it.In addition, rich in nutrition content in wasp larva and pupal cell, edible, high nutritive value, can develop various nutraceutical.Therefore, cultivate wasp and there is higher economic benefit and wide DEVELOPMENT PROSPECT.
But, 5 key technologies are related in wasp cultivation, wherein cultivating and collect female drone is a difficult point, the method that current collection wasp among the people is female, drone adopts is: bee-keeping personnel wear the honeycomb that anti-honeybee clothes excavate wasp, from honeycomb, queen bee and drone are taken out one by one, be put in honeybee cage respectively, take back male and female mating booth again, this method bothers very much, and can accurately not judge female drone oestrus, therefore often occur the problem that female drone mating effect is undesirable, queen bee is of poor quality, thus hindering wasp bee colony to grow, culture benefit is not good.
Therefore, be badly in need of providing a kind of female drone can cultivating and collect oestrus accurately, efficiently, automatically, in batches, improve female drone mating quality, the device of acquisition high-quality queen bee.

Embodiment
Be further described the utility model below in conjunction with accompanying drawing, but limited the utility model never in any form, any conversion done based on the utility model training centre or replacement, all belong to protection domain of the present utility model.
As shown in Figure 1, the utility model comprises the raising shed 1 and mating canopy 2 that adopt thin wire gauze to make, described mating canopy 2 is arranged multiple suck-back device 8 in horn-like structure; Arrange Honeybee raising device 3 in described raising shed 1, described Honeybee raising device 3 is cylindrical tree cylinder or the wooden case of hollow, and the two ends of described tree cylinder or wooden case are closed with thin wire gauze 10 respectively, closes outside described thin wire gauze 10 with plank 11 to be opened/closed; Described Honeybee raising device 3 is arranged and draws honeybee device 4, described one end of drawing honeybee device 4 is communicated with Honeybee raising device 3, it is outside that the described other end drawing honeybee device 4 stretches out raising shed 1, it is arranged the suck-back device 8 in horn-like structure, described drawing on sidewall that honeybee device 4 stretches out raising shed 1 outside arranges the first outlet 5 and the second outlet 6 respectively, described first outlet 5 places arrange plastic wire, the mesh size of the plastic wire that described first outlet 5 place is arranged is 1.5cm, and only the individual less worker bee of permission, drone climb out of from above-mentioned mesh; Described second outlet 6 is communicated with mating canopy 2 by arranging netted passage 7, and the mesh size of described netted passage 7 is 1.5cm, and only the individual less worker bee of permission, drone climb out of from above-mentioned mesh; And described netted passage 7 tilts upward setting, its low side connects the second outlet 6 that cultivator 4 is arranged, its high-end connection mating canopy 2.
operation principle of the present utility model and the course of work:
Honeybee raising device 3 in the utility model is cylindrical tree cylinder or the wooden case of hollow, by wasp cultivation is being set in cylinder or wooden case, bee colony near the nuptial flight phase time honeycomb of Honeybee raising device 3 and the inside, worker bee are together moved on in raising shed 1, Honeybee raising device 3 just becomes bee-keeping and cultivates the device of female drone, then Honeybee raising device 3 put into by the female drone of other nest wasp of periodic collection field and king's cake honeycomb, fed by the worker bee of this nest honeybee.Realize like this: feed the larva on not brood female drone and king's cake honeycomb with the worker bee of a brood of wasp; Be combined with not brood female drone, avoid the generation with the mating of a brood of male and female honeybee and inbreeding situation; Reach bee-keeping and cultivate female drone with worker bee, reducing the object of artificial culture labour cost.
Worker bee in Honeybee raising device 3 on honeycomb and reach maturity enter oestrus queen bee, drone along draw honeybee device 4 climb out of time, climb out of from the first outlet 5 and the second outlet 6 owing to changing by the stop of suck-back device 8, the worker bee climbed out of from the first outlet 5 directly flies to wild environment search of food, the drone climbed out of from the first outlet 5 temporarily flies to wild environment, when being subject to the induction of queen bee sex hormone, can fly back; Export 6 queen bees climbed out of, drone and worker bee from second and enter netted passage 7, because the mesh diameter of netted passage 7 is less, drone and worker bee can only be allowed directly to fly in wild environment, and queen bee individuality can not climb out of greatly, under the instinctive behavior of upwards creeping wasp class insect is ordered about, queen bee is advanced into mating canopy 2 on netted passage 7, realizes automatic, that batch collection reaches maturity the queen bee (accurate queen bee) entering oestrus object thus; Other drone in the drone of raising shed 1 and wild environment that flies out large quantities ofly returns netted passage 7 with queen bee because being subject to the induction of the sex hormone that queen bee sends in mating canopy 2 and together enters mating canopy 2, some can enter mating canopy 2 from the suck-back device 8 of mating canopy 2, realizes automatic, that batch collection reaches maturity the drone entering oestrus object thus; Thus achieve accurately, efficient, automatically, batch collection reaches maturity and enter the female drone in oestrus, effectively improve wasp female drone mating quality, obtain the object of high-quality queen bee.
The worker bee climbing out of raising shed 1 flies to wild environment predation, get myron after when returning, enter Honeybee raising device 3 from being arranged at the suck-back device 8 drawn honeybee device 4 or entering netted passage 7 from the mesh of netted passage 7, then drive in the wrong direction along netted passage 7 and enter Honeybee raising device 3 downwards, for the female drone of the larva of bee in Honeybee raising device 3, the tender honeybee of children, old queen bee and undeveloped mature provides required food, until female drone reaches maturity enter oestrus, the female drone in oestrus ceaselessly finds the outlet of the Honeybee raising device 3 that flies out under the ordering about of instinctive behavior.
The two ends of Honeybee raising device 3 are closed with thin wire gauze 10 respectively, close with plank 11 to be opened/closed outside described thin wire gauze 10, open plank 11, old queen to lay eggs can be observed across thin wire gauze 10 zero distance, egg hatching, larva of bee growth, larvae pupation, pupa emergence, worker bee feeding, worker bee nest and the behavior of the wasp bee colony such as the tender female drone of children is movable, for further scientific research wasp biological behaviour and exploitation wasp aptoxin resource lay the first stone.
